Ridley Scott directs Alien: Covenant, the 2017 science-fiction horror film that continues the Alien series. Set aboard the colony ship Covenant, the story follows a crew heading for a remote planet on the far side of the galaxy, where an apparently uncharted world begins to reveal a far more threatening nature. The film blends space travel, androids, alien life, and the consequences of experimentation and genetic mutation within a tense mystery-thriller framework.
Made in the United Kingdom and the United States and released in English, the film runs 122 minutes and is rated R. Michael Fassbender leads the cast, with Katherine Waterston, Billy Crudup, Danny McBride, and Demián Bichir among the principal performers. Alien: Covenant is presented as a sequel and carries the series’ familiar focus on creation, infection, and encounters with alien technology.
